项目软件管理有哪些
-
已被采纳为最佳回答
项目软件管理主要包括项目计划、资源分配、风险管理、质量控制等方面,确保项目的顺利进行和高效交付。 在这些方面中,项目计划是最基础也是最重要的环节。它不仅涉及到项目目标的设定,还包括制定详细的时间表、预算和里程碑。有效的项目计划能够为团队提供明确的方向,确保所有成员对项目的期望一致,同时也能有效地管理客户的期望,减少不必要的沟通成本。通过项目计划,团队能够提前识别可能的瓶颈和挑战,及时调整策略,确保项目按照既定的时间和质量标准完成。
一、项目计划
项目计划是项目管理的核心,涵盖了从初步构想到项目实施的各个阶段。一个成功的项目计划需要明确项目的目标、范围、时间框架和资源需求。 在这一过程中,项目经理需要与各个利益相关者进行深入沟通,确保大家对项目的理解一致。项目计划通常包括以下几个关键组成部分:
- 项目目标:明确项目的最终目标,确保所有团队成员对目标有清晰的认识。
- 时间管理:制定详细的时间表,包括各个阶段的起止时间和关键里程碑。
- 资源分配:确定项目所需的资源,包括人力、物力和财力,并合理分配。
- 风险评估:识别可能影响项目的风险,并制定应对策略。
在项目计划的实施过程中,定期的进度检查和调整是非常重要的。这不仅可以及时发现问题,还能确保项目始终朝着既定目标前进。
二、资源分配
资源分配是项目管理的另一个重要方面,涉及到人力资源、财务预算和技术支持等。有效的资源分配能够提高项目的效率和成功率。 在这一过程中,项目经理需要根据项目的需求和团队的能力进行合理的资源配置,确保每个成员都能发挥其最大潜力。资源分配的有效性还体现在以下几个方面:
- 人力资源:根据项目的需求,合理安排团队成员的任务和职责,确保每个人都能充分发挥其专长。
- 财务管理:制定详细的预算计划,严格控制项目的费用支出,确保项目在预算范围内完成。
- 技术支持:确保项目所需的技术资源和工具到位,支持团队的日常工作。
在资源分配的过程中,项目经理还需要不断监控资源的使用情况,确保不出现浪费或短缺,从而保持项目的高效运作。
三、风险管理
风险管理是项目软件管理中不可或缺的一部分,旨在识别、评估和应对项目过程中可能出现的各种风险。有效的风险管理能够帮助项目团队提前采取措施,降低风险对项目的影响。 风险管理的过程通常包括以下几个步骤:
- 风险识别:通过团队讨论、专家访谈等方式,识别出可能影响项目的风险因素。
- 风险评估:对识别出的风险进行评估,分析其发生的可能性和对项目的影响程度。
- 应对策略:制定应对策略,包括规避风险、减轻风险、转移风险和接受风险等。
- 监控与调整:在项目实施过程中,持续监控风险的变化情况,必要时调整应对策略。
通过系统化的风险管理,项目团队能够有效减少不确定性,提高项目的成功率。
四、质量控制
质量控制是项目软件管理的重要组成部分,旨在确保项目交付的产品或服务符合预定的质量标准。质量控制不仅关乎客户的满意度,也直接影响项目的声誉和团队的信任度。 在进行质量控制时,项目经理需要关注以下几个方面:
- 质量标准制定:明确项目的质量标准,包括功能、性能、安全性等方面的要求。
- 质量审查:在项目实施的各个阶段,定期进行质量审查,确保产品或服务符合质量标准。
- 缺陷管理:及时识别和记录项目中的缺陷,并制定相应的修复计划。
- 客户反馈:积极收集客户的反馈意见,以便在后续的工作中进行改进。
通过全面的质量控制,项目团队能够确保产品的高质量交付,从而提升客户满意度和市场竞争力。
五、团队沟通与协作
有效的团队沟通与协作是项目成功的关键因素之一。团队成员之间的良好沟通能够提高工作效率,减少误解和冲突。 在项目管理过程中,项目经理需要采取一些有效的沟通策略:
- 定期会议:定期召开项目进度会议,确保团队成员及时了解项目的最新动态。
- 沟通工具:使用合适的沟通工具,如项目管理软件、即时通讯工具等,提高沟通效率。
- 透明信息:确保项目相关信息的透明,所有团队成员都能获取到必要的信息。
- 反馈机制:建立有效的反馈机制,鼓励团队成员提出意见和建议,以便不断改进工作流程。
通过优化团队沟通与协作,项目经理能够提升团队的凝聚力和工作效率,为项目的成功奠定良好的基础。
六、项目评估与总结
项目评估与总结是项目管理的重要环节,旨在对项目的整体表现进行回顾和分析。通过系统的评估与总结,团队能够识别成功的经验和需要改进的地方,为未来的项目提供宝贵的参考。 在项目结束后,项目经理应关注以下几个方面:
- 目标达成情况:评估项目是否达成预定目标,包括时间、成本和质量等方面。
- 问题与挑战:总结项目过程中遇到的问题和挑战,分析其原因及影响。
- 经验教训:记录项目中的成功经验和失败教训,为未来的项目提供参考。
- 团队反馈:收集团队成员的反馈意见,促进团队的成长和发展。
通过认真进行项目评估与总结,项目团队能够不断优化工作流程,提高未来项目的成功率。
七、工具与技术的应用
在项目软件管理中,工具与技术的应用能够显著提高工作效率和项目透明度。合理选择和使用项目管理工具,能够帮助团队更好地进行任务分配、进度追踪和沟通协作。 当前市场上有许多项目管理工具,如JIRA、Trello、Asana等,项目经理可以根据项目的特点和团队的需求进行选择。工具的应用主要体现在以下几个方面:
- 任务管理:通过任务管理工具,团队成员可以清晰地了解各自的任务和截止日期,提高工作效率。
- 进度追踪:项目经理可以通过工具实时监控项目进度,及时发现问题并进行调整。
- 文档管理:使用云存储和文档管理工具,确保项目文档的及时更新和共享,提高信息的透明度。
- 数据分析:通过数据分析工具,项目经理可以获取项目的各项指标,辅助决策。
通过合理应用工具与技术,项目团队能够更高效地进行管理和协作,提升项目的整体表现。
八、持续改进与优化
持续改进与优化是项目管理的长期目标,旨在通过不断的反馈和调整,提升项目管理的效率和效果。在项目管理中,持续改进不仅关乎项目本身,也对团队的整体发展具有重要意义。 项目经理可以采取以下措施实现持续改进:
- 定期评估:定期对项目管理流程进行评估,识别其中的不足之处。
- 学习机制:建立团队学习机制,鼓励团队成员分享经验和知识,促进团队的成长。
- 反馈循环:通过建立有效的反馈循环,及时获取客户和团队的意见,进行相应的调整。
- 创新实践:鼓励团队尝试新的方法和工具,不断探索优化项目管理的可能性。
通过持续改进与优化,项目团队能够不断提升管理水平,提高项目的成功率和客户满意度。
项目软件管理是一个复杂而系统的过程,涉及到多个方面的内容。有效的项目管理能够确保项目的顺利进行,提升团队的工作效率和客户的满意度。在具体实施过程中,项目经理需要根据项目的特点,灵活运用各种管理策略和工具,确保项目在规定的时间、成本和质量范围内成功交付。
1年前 -
项目软件管理是指对软件开发项目中的软件进行规划、跟踪、监控和控制,以确保项目按时交付、在预算范围内,并同时满足质量和范围要求。项目软件管理涵盖了许多方面,下面列举了一些重要的项目软件管理内容:
-
项目规划:项目软件管理的第一步是制定项目计划。这包括确定项目目标和范围、制定工作分解结构(WBS)、制定进度计划和资源分配计划等。同时还需要对风险进行评估和管理,以及进行沟通计划和质量计划。
-
需求管理:项目软件管理需要对软件需求进行管理,包括识别、分析、规划和跟踪需求。这需要确保软件开发团队了解并满足用户和利益相关者的需求,以及及时处理需求变更。
-
配置管理:配置管理是指对软件和相关文档进行控制和跟踪,以确保在整个开发过程中都能够保持一致性和可追溯性。配置管理包括版本控制、变更控制、配置审核和配置项状态报告等内容。
-
进度和成本控制:项目软件管理需要监控项目进度和成本,确保项目按照计划进行,并在预算范围内。这需要对项目的进度、资源使用情况和成本进行跟踪和控制,并及时采取行动应对延迟和超支情况。
-
质量管理:质量管理是项目软件管理中非常重要的一部分,包括制定质量策略、规划质量控制和质量保证,实施质量检查和测试,对缺陷进行管理和改进过程等。
-
风险管理:在项目软件管理中,需要对项目的风险进行识别、分析和规划应对措施,以确保项目能够在风险可控的范围内进行。
-
沟通管理:沟通是项目软件管理中非常重要的一部分,需要对团队内部和利益相关者之间的沟通进行规划和管理,确保信息传递清晰和及时。
以上是项目软件管理中的一些重要内容,这些内容相互交织、相互作用,共同确保项目的成功交付。
1年前 -
-
在项目管理中,软件管理是一个重要的部分,它主要涉及到对所有项目软件进行规划、监控和控制,以确保项目顺利完成。软件管理涵盖了多个方面,包括软件需求管理、软件配置管理、软件质量管理、软件变更管理等等。以下是项目软件管理中常见的几个方面:
软件需求管理:软件需求管理是指确定、分析、记录和管理软件项目的需求。这包括识别项目的功能和性能需求、确认用户需求、分析需求的可行性和优先级等。软件需求管理有助于确保项目团队了解客户的需求,以便按时交付满足客户期望的软件产品。
软件配置管理:软件配置管理是确保项目软件配置项的唯一性、可追踪性和完整性的过程。它包括对软件配置项进行识别、版本控制、变更控制、配置状态报告等活动。通过软件配置管理,可以有效地跟踪和管理软件项目中的各个软件配置项,确保软件开发过程的可追溯性和一致性。
软件质量管理:软件质量管理是确保项目软件达到预定质量标准的过程。它包括计划质量管理、质量保证和质量控制等活动。软件质量管理旨在识别和解决软件开发过程中可能出现的质量问题,从而提高软件项目的质量和客户满意度。
软件变更管理:软件变更管理是管理软件开发过程中的变更请求,确保对软件配置项的变更得到适当评估、批准和实施的过程。软件变更管理包括变更请求的识别、评估、控制和实施等环节。通过有效的软件变更管理,可以避免未经审批的变更对项目进度和质量造成负面影响。
综上所述,项目软件管理涉及到软件需求管理、软件配置管理、软件质量管理、软件变更管理等多个方面。这些软件管理活动有助于确保项目能够按时交付符合质量要求的软件产品,满足客户的需求和期望。
1年前 -
在项目软件管理中,通常涉及以下几个方面的内容:
- 需求管理
- 进度管理
- 质量管理
- 风险管理
- 变更管理
- 交付管理
接下来将围绕这几个方面展开详细介绍。
1. 需求管理
需求管理是项目软件管理的核心之一。它包括以下几个步骤:
- 需求收集:收集用户、客户或利益相关者提出的需求,并理解需求背后的目的。
- 需求分析:对需求进行分析,明确需求之间的关系和优先级。
- 需求确认:通过与利益相关者沟通确认需求,确保需求的准确性和完整性。
- 需求跟踪:跟踪需求的变化,及时处理需求的变更。
2. 进度管理
进度管理是确保项目按计划进行的重要一环。主要包括以下步骤:
- 制定项目计划:根据需求和资源情况制定项目计划,明确项目的时间节点和里程碑。
- 监控进度:监控项目实际进度与计划进度的差距,并及时采取措施做出调整。
- 资源分配:合理分配人力、物力、财力等资源,确保项目进度顺利推进。
- 沟通与协调:项目团队成员之间及时沟通、协调工作,保证整个项目团队朝着设定的目标前进。
3. 质量管理
质量管理是项目交付成功的关键要素之一。具体实施步骤如下:
- 质量规划:确定项目的质量标准和质量控制措施。
- 质量保证:通过审核、检验等方式确保项目交付的产品或服务符合标准。
- 质量控制:监控和调整项目过程,防止质量问题发生。
4. 风险管理
风险管理是为了预见并应对项目可能面临的风险。具体包括以下内容:
- 风险识别:识别项目可能面临的各种风险,包括技术风险、商业风险等。
- 风险评估:评估风险的概率和影响程度,确定优先处理的风险。
- 风险应对:制定风险应对计划,包括风险避免、减轻、转移和接受等策略。
5. 变更管理
变更管理是为了有效地管理项目过程中的变更,确保项目不受变更的影响。具体步骤如下:
- 变更识别:识别项目中的变更需求。
- 变更评估:评估变更对项目进度、成本、资源等方面的影响。
- 变更控制:审核、批准和控制变更的实施,避免变更对项目带来负面影响。
6. 交付管理
交付管理是在项目完成后将成果交付给客户或利益相关者的过程。主要包括以下几个步骤:
- 交付计划:制定交付计划,明确交付时间、方式和内容。
- 交付实施:按计划将项目成果交付给客户或利益相关者。
- 验收:客户对项目成果进行验收,确认是否符合需求和预期。
综上所述,项目软件管理涵盖了多个方面的内容,需要全面考虑并加以有效管理,才能确保项目的顺利完成。
1年前